    My plants keep toppling over

    yeah, fill the pot all the way up. You could also use one of those fuzzy pipe cleaners, make a small hole in the rim of the pot, anchor the pipe cleaner to the pot and make a loop several times bigger than the stem. The bristles don't create pressure points on the stem. I use them to LST with.

    Best way to get rid of thrips and spidermites??

    Abamectin E Pro 0.15 (which is the same as avid) protects for 4 weeks and kills aphids, thrips, spidermites and whiteflies. Floramite and Forbid work great also, but I wouldn't use any of them past the first week of flowering.
